Buying Guide: How To Choose The Best Baby Hair Pins
What to look for in baby hair pins
- Fully lined clips to reduce hair pull and snagging.
- Lightweight design to prevent discomfort for infants and toddlers.
- Non-slip features or velvet inner ribbons for secure hold on fine hair.
- Quality materials that are gentle on sensitive scalps.
- Appropriate size for age and hair type (e.g., 1.8–2.0 inches for older babies; smaller for newborns).
Should you prioritize quantity or variety?
For everyday use, a larger set with varied colors helps match more outfits. If you expect frequent outings or photoshoots, a curated mix of reliable, non-slip clips with different patterns can be more practical than dozens of nearly identical pieces.
What about safety concerns?
Choose clips with smooth edges, no sharp points, and non-toxic materials. Avoid clips with loose parts or embellishments that could detach and become a choking hazard.
Care and maintenance tips
- Wipe clips with a soft damp cloth after wear to remove oils and sunscreen.
- Avoid using harsh chemicals on fabric-covered clips.
- Store in a box or pouch to prevent tangling and keep hair oils away from the clips’ surfaces.

Frequently asked questions
- Are baby hair pins safe for newborns? Yes, when they have smooth edges, are fully lined, and lack small detachable parts; always supervise young children while wearing clips.
- What size is best for a toddler? Approximately 1.8–2 inches works well for most toddlers; adjust if your child has thicker hair or a larger head.
- Do these clips damage hair? Look for clips with fully covered bases and gentle materials to reduce pulling on delicate strands.
- Should I choose cotton or grosgrain ribbons? Cotton is softer for sensitive scalps, while grosgrain offers more durability and color stability for everyday wear.
- Can these clips stay in place during active play? Non-slip designs and inner velvet ribbons improve grip, but active infants may require occasional repositioning.
